"In June 1905, we're told, the sailing ship Hollandia set sail from Norway for a secret destination: the South Pole, a white and inhospitable void at the end of the world. In 1941, an interviewer tracked down and filmed the expedition's sole survivor, a ship's carpenter, in a tiny Irish cottage. The old man recounted the fate of his companions: an outlandish tale of obsession, murder, cannibalism and mystical redemption"--Container.
